What is the TCF Exam?
Before diving into the exam dates, it is essential to comprehend what the TCF test entails. The TCF is made up of numerous modules that check different language skills:
- Listening Comprehension: 29 concerns, lasting 25 minutes.
- Reading Comprehension: 39 concerns, lasting 45 minutes.
- Structure of Language: 40 questions, lasting 15 minutes.
- Speaking: An oral interview lasting 20 minutes.
- Writing: A written test including 3 tasks, lasting 60 minutes.
The TCF is scored on a scale from A1 (beginner) to C2 (competent), with each level representing a degree of language mastery.

How to Register
To sign up for the TCF exam, candidates should follow these actions:
- Choose an Exam Center: Select an authorized TCF test center based on individual benefit and the accessibility of examination dates.
- Complete the Registration Form: This can generally be done online or in individual at the test center.
- Pay the Exam Fee: The expense of the TCF test varies by location however usually varies from EUR100 to EUR150. Make certain to pay the charge before the registration deadline.
- Receive Confirmation: Once the registration is complete, candidates will get a verification email with details about the examination date, place, and other essential info.

4. Is the TCF exam recognized worldwide?
Yes, the TCF examination is acknowledged by many universities and expert companies around the world. It is especially important for those considering studying or working in French-speaking nations.
5. The length of time are TCF ratings legitimate?
TCF ratings typically remain legitimate for two years; nevertheless, this can vary depending upon the organization or organization requesting evidence of language proficiency.
